Bisacodyl and Weight fluctuation - a phase IV clinical study of FDA data
Summary:
Weight fluctuation is reported as a side effect among people who take Bisacodyl (bisacodyl), especially for people who are male, 60+ old, also take Vitamin B12, and have Parkinson's disease.
The phase IV clinical study analyzes which people have Weight fluctuation when taking Bisacodyl. It is created by eHealthMe based on reports of 18,779 people who have side effects when taking Bisacodyl from the FDA, and is updated regularly.

18,779 people reported to have side effects when taking Bisacodyl.
Among them, 41 people (0.22%) have Weight fluctuation.

Among these 41 people:
What is the gender of people who have Weight fluctuation when taking Bisacodyl? *
- female: 20 %
- male: 80 %
What is the age of people who have Weight fluctuation when taking Bisacodyl? *
- 0-1: 0.0 %
- 2-9: 0.0 %
- 10-19: 0.0 %
- 20-29: 0.0 %
- 30-39: 0.0 %
- 40-49: 0.0 %
- 50-59: 3.85 %
- 60+: 96.15 %
What are other drugs people take besides Bisacodyl? *
- Vitamin B12: 21 people, 51.22%
- Colestid: 20 people, 48.78%
- Vitamin D3: 20 people, 48.78%
- Pancreatin: 19 people, 46.34%
- Imodium: 16 people, 39.02%
- Lasix: 4 people, 9.76%
- Cyanocobalamin: 4 people, 9.76%
- Albuterol: 3 people, 7.32%
- Aspirin: 3 people, 7.32%
- Advil: 2 people, 4.88%
What are other side effects people have besides Weight fluctuation? *
- Diarrhea: 21 people, 51.22%
- Abdominal Pain Upper: 20 people, 48.78%
- Large Intestinal Ulcer: 20 people, 48.78%
- Weight Decreased: 14 people, 34.15%
- Confusional State: 14 people, 34.15%
- Agitation (state of anxiety or nervous excitement): 12 people, 29.27%
- Appetite - Decreased (decreased appetite occurs when you have a reduced desire to eat): 12 people, 29.27%
- Hoarseness Or Changing Voice: 11 people, 26.83%
- Paraesthesia (sensation of tingling, tickling, prickling, pricking, or burning of a person's skin with no apparent long-term physical effect): 11 people, 26.83%
- Parkinson's Disease: 11 people, 26.83%
What are the existing conditions these people have? *
- Parkinson's Disease: 13 people, 31.71%
- Fibroma (tumours that are composed of fibrous or connective tissue): 4 people, 9.76%
- Rheumatoid Arthritis (a chronic progressive disease causing inflammation in the joints): 2 people, 4.88%
- Primary Pulmonary Hypertension (primary high blood pressure that affects the arteries in the lungs and the right side of your heart): 1 person, 2.44%
- Nausea (feeling of having an urge to vomit): 1 person, 2.44%
- Lung Neoplasm Malignant (cancer tumour of lung): 1 person, 2.44%
- Lung Cancer - Non-Small Cell (lung cancer): 1 person, 2.44%
- Infusion Site Pain: 1 person, 2.44%
- Crohn's Disease (a condition that causes inflammation of the gastrointestinal tract): 1 person, 2.44%
- Bleeding Disorders: 1 person, 2.44%
* Approximation only. Some reports may have incomplete information.

How the study uses the data?
The study uses data from the FDA. It is based on bisacodyl (the active ingredients of Bisacodyl) and Bisacodyl (the brand name). Other drugs that have the same active ingredients (e.g. generic drugs) are not considered. Dosage of drugs is not considered in the study.
